Advanced Ultra High-Strength Steel, continuing the discussion from TLT with Ted McClure
In this episode, we talk to Ted McClure, Manager at TribSys LLC, who discusses his interview for the feature article on advanced ultra high-strength steel (A-UHSS) that appeared in the July issue of Tribology & Lubrication Technology. We get some more information on some of his recent work including the project with the Auto-Steel Partnership, providing more depth on the article.
To provide some background, A-UHSS is revolutionizing the auto industry due to low weight, high strength and ability to absorb and repel energy. Its unique properties allow it to meet new requirements and standards, yet this material requires specialized lubrication considerations. According to the American Iron and Steel Institute, "advanced high-strength steels (AHSS) require less energy and emissions to produce than other automotive structural materials, make lighter parts that reduce vehicle weight and increase fuel economy, and are fully recyclable."

Chemical Mechanical Polishing (CMP) with Sukbae Joo
This episode features a focus on CMP, chemical mechanical planarization/polishing, and ECMP, electrochemical mechanical planarization/polishing. Sukbae Joo, a PhD candidate at Texas A&M, is conducting research in this field, and provides his perspective on CMP/ECMP and its role within the tribology field. He includes some of the challenges presented by this type of work, but also the successes he's had. To listen, click play in the slider bar above, download the episode, or read/translate the transcript.
This research plays an important role in the semiconductor industry, given that this method is used to create objects like optical lenses, LCD panels, MEMS, field emission displays, and plasma display panels (PDP) for televisions. These consumer applications are constantly changing and being improved upon - which creates a need for better methods and technology to create the products. CMP/ECMP is a path to that goal.

Cell Adhesion in Nanotribology with Aracely Rocha
In this episode, we talk to Aracely Rocha, who has been doing research in the field of nanotribology for biological applications. Her focus has been on how materials at various scales interact with biomolecules. She has tried to quantify this interaction through adhesion. In a paper, Aracely and her co-authors posit that "measuring cell adhesion has become critical for design and development of materials and devices for biological applications." Her work could impact a number of biological applications, including improving the life of artificial joints, or the efficiency of drug delivery. Tribochemistry and Nanoscale Surface Interactions in Nanotribology with David Huitink
In this episode, we discuss the interesting and growing field of nanotribology from a PhD student's perspective. David Huitink attends Texas A&M and is active in STLE. Most recently, he founded the Texas A&M University Chapter of STLE and served as its President in 2010. Listen as David discusses his work: using nanoscale contact to study friction and tribochemical reactions. This involves studying the chemical and interfacial reactions taking place at the nanoscale as a result of friction and contact forces.
